Texas Education Code
§ 29.356 — APPLICATION TO PROGRAM

View on source(a)A parent of an eligible child may apply to a certified educational assistance organization designated by the comptroller to enroll the child in the program for the following semester, term, or school year, as determined by the comptroller. The comptroller shall establish deadlines by which an applicant must complete and submit an application form to participate in the program.
(b)On receipt of more acceptable applications during an application period for admission under this section than available positions in the program due to insufficient funding, a certified educational assistance organization shall, at the direction of the comptroller, fill the available positions by lottery of applicants, approving applicants:
(1)in the following order:
(A)siblings of participating children;
(B)children to whom Paragraph (C) does not apply; and
(C)children who previously ceased participation in the program due to enrollment in a school district or open-enrollment charter school; and

Legislative history
Added by Acts 2025, 89th Leg., R.S., Ch. 2 (S.B. 2), Sec. 2, eff. September 1, 2025.
